Legislative Session number- 83

Bill Name: SF2148

Relating to controlled substance crimes; requiring the court to order+ persons
convicted of manufacturing or attempting to manufacture controlled +substances
or of illegal activities involving precursor substances requiring an +emergency
response to pay restitution to the public entities participating in +the
response to cover response costs, authorizing the court to reduce the+ amount of
restitution under indigency conditions; creating certain new +controlled
substance crimes involving children and vulnerable adults; defining +certain
terms, imposing a criminal penalty for violation and providing for +multiple or
consecutive sentences; specifying certain child custody, reporting +and notice
requirements of peace officers in crime situations involving children+ and
providing for placement or release of children taken into custody; +specifying
certain vulnerable adult abuse reporting requirements of peace +officers in
controlled substance crime situations involving vulnerable adults and+ certain
investigation duties of law enforcement agencies and certain +protective
services requirements of county social service agencies; creating the
methamphetamine awareness and educational account in the special +revenue fund
and appropriating money in the account to the commissioner of public +safety for
educational initiatives relating to the dangers of methamphetamines +and
methamphetamine precursor drugs and the laws and regulations +governing use (mk)
